Fake Diploma "Review" Sites

When was the last time you Google'd yourself?

We Google ourselves from time to time here at DiplomaXpress and we seem to always be coming across new "fake diploma review" websites.

If you haven't caught on to the gag yet, "fake diploma review" sites are almost ALWAYS owned by one of the other fake diploma sites online.

A lot of "fake diploma" websites use these "review" sites as a marketing tool to not only promote their own sites, but bash their competitors as well. They almost always rank their own fake diploma sites the highest and generally rank whoever they consider to be their stiffest competition the lowest.

Of course some of the REALLY bad fake diploma site owners will even go beyond that by posting "reviews", "scam warnings", and "rip-off reports" on other sites posing as customers of their competitors. These are generally just the really shady sites that are always popping up and disappearing though.

I think it is important to note that NOT EVERY "fake diploma" website online is out to rip people off. There are actually a handful of decent, honest fake diploma websites online today.
